EARTHSONGS FOR CHORUS AND ORCHESTRA
by Michael Mauldin
Commissioned by the Albuquerque Youth Symphony Program,
to be premiered as the second half of its American Music Concert
in Popejoy Hall, 7:30 PM on Saturday, January 30, 2010 by the
90-piece Albuquerque Youth Symphony, a 200-voice adult chorus (including members of several civic choruses and the choirs of Sandia and Eldorado High Schools), a 30-voice children’s chorus, four adult soloists (UNM vocal students), and a boy-soprano soloist.
